I’ve said for years the PSA product line-up is a pig’s ear – neither brand knows whether it’s a value or premium brand, both Peugeot and Citroën sell budget and premium models with crossovers at various points in the range. At the bottom-end Citroëns are the cheapy cars, Peugeot Citroën then compete with each other in the mid-range, further up, Citroën become the premium models and then Peugeot have an expensive Coupe plonked at the top of the PSA price structure!
Peugeot should be a low budget brand to compete with the likes of Dacia, Citroën being the premium versions of the various platforms. Something everybody can understand.
